Why Emirates Airlines Are Leaving Nigeria

On Thursday 18th August, 2022, Emirates airline said they are taking a difficult decision of deferring all flights to and from Nigeria as from 1st September.

This is due to the inability to repatriate its $85 million revenue from Nigeria. It also reported on March that the airline lost the sum of $1.1 billion due to the soaring of fuel prices. Other causes of their loss include inflation, political and economic uncertainty.
